The Rise of Red Dot Optics
The world of firearms has undergone a dramatic transformation in recent years, fueled by technological advancements and a growing emphasis on accuracy and efficiency. One of the most significant shifts has been the rise of red dot optics. These compact, battery-powered sights project a red illuminated dot onto the target, allowing for rapid target acquisition and improved accuracy, especially in dynamic or low-light situations. From concealed carry pistols to competition rifles, red dots have become a staple for both seasoned shooters and newcomers alike.

Key Technologies
Let’s explore some of the key technologies that define Holosun red dot sights:
Shake Awake Technology
This clever innovation is a battery-saving marvel. When the optic senses inactivity, it automatically enters a sleep mode, conserving battery power. When the firearm is moved or jostled, the optic instantly wakes up, displaying the reticle for immediate target engagement. This is critical for self-defense applications where a red dot needs to be ready instantly.
Multiple Reticle Systems
Holosun is known for offering flexible reticle options. Many models feature a standard 2 MOA dot combined with a 65 MOA circle. This “circle dot” reticle provides excellent target acquisition speed for close-quarters scenarios while allowing for precision aiming at longer distances with the central dot. Some also offer a simple dot only option.
Exceptional Battery Life
Holosun places a significant emphasis on extending battery life. Their optics utilize efficient circuitry and often feature advanced power-saving modes. Many models deliver thousands of hours of runtime, reducing the frequency of battery changes and enhancing the user experience.
Rugged Build Quality
Holosun optics are built to endure the rigors of real-world use. They typically feature robust housings crafted from durable materials, such as aluminum. They are often waterproof and shockproof, allowing reliable performance in adverse conditions.
Solar Failsafe
Some premium Holosun models incorporate a solar panel on top of the optic. This adds an additional power source to prolong battery life and even allows the optic to function even when the battery is depleted, provided there’s sufficient ambient light. This is a valuable backup mechanism, particularly for critical applications.
Popular Models
Holosun offers a diverse catalog of red dot sights. Several models stand out as particularly popular choices:
Holosun 507C
This is a compact, open-emitter red dot sight that is popular for pistols. It is known for its Shake Awake technology, the multiple reticle system (circle dot), and excellent battery life. Its rugged construction and competitive price point make it a very attractive offering.
Holosun 507K
This is a smaller, more streamlined version designed for subcompact pistols, ideal for concealed carry. The 507K shares many of the same features as the 507C, including Shake Awake, the multiple reticle system, and a long battery life, all while being designed for maximum concealment.
Holosun 510C
A larger, open-emitter red dot designed for rifles and carbines. It features a large viewing window, a circle dot reticle, and a solar panel for extended battery life. The 510C’s robust design and clear sight picture make it a great choice for tactical applications.
These are just a few examples of the variety Holosun offers. Each model is designed to fulfill a specific need.

Key Features
Here’s a closer look at some of the notable features you’ll find in Sig Romeo red dot sights:
MOTAC/Shake Awake Technology
Sig Sauer incorporates a motion-activated illumination system, which they call MOTAC (Motion Activated Illumination System) or Shake Awake in some models. Similar to Holosun’s, this technology helps conserve battery life by automatically turning off the reticle when the optic is idle and instantly activating it when motion is detected.
Reticle Options
While not always as varied as some Holosun models, Sig Romeo optics typically offer well-designed reticles, often featuring a crisp, easy-to-see dot that’s ideal for fast target acquisition. The dot brightness can usually be adjusted to the specific lighting conditions.
Battery Life
Sig Sauer Romeo optics are known for respectable battery life. Through the use of efficient electronics and optimized design, they can achieve hundreds or even thousands of hours of use on a single battery, allowing for less maintenance and more shooting time.
Durability
Sig Sauer’s optics are engineered for durability. They often feature robust construction with tough materials, resisting impacts and ensuring dependable performance in various environments. Many models are also waterproof and fog proof, designed to endure demanding conditions.
Brightness Settings
The adjustable brightness levels are crucial for optimizing performance in different lighting conditions. Sig Romeo sights often provide a wide range of brightness settings, allowing shooters to customize the reticle’s visibility for a perfect sight picture in bright sunlight or low-light situations.
Build Quality
Sig Sauer optics maintain the brand’s reputation for quality, with robust construction, high-quality lenses, and rigorous quality control. This ensures reliability and a long service life.

Head-to-Head Comparison
Pricing
Holosun generally maintains a slight edge in price, offering exceptional value for the features they provide. You’ll often find Holosun optics are a bit more affordable, making them a more accessible option for a wide range of shooters. Sig Sauer Romeo optics, while still competitively priced, are often positioned at a slightly higher price point, reflecting the brand’s commitment to premium quality.
Build Quality and Durability
Both brands offer durable optics, but there are some nuances. Holosun optics are known for being rugged and reliable. Sig Sauer Romeo models often showcase a more refined build with high-quality materials. Both brands are built to withstand impacts, water exposure, and other environmental stressors.
Reticle Options
Holosun offers a broader array of reticle choices, including the popular circle dot reticle system. Sig Sauer primarily offers a well-defined dot reticle, which is excellent for quick target acquisition, but generally with fewer variations. This can be a significant consideration for shooters looking for specific aiming aids.
Battery Life and Power Management
Both brands offer excellent battery life thanks to efficient circuitry and power-saving technologies. Both utilize Shake Awake or MOTAC systems to conserve battery life. However, some users report slightly longer battery life on some Holosun models, depending on the features.
Features
Holosun often packs more features into their optics, such as solar panels, which significantly extend battery life. Sig Sauer focuses more on a core set of features designed for reliable performance.
User Experience and Performance
Both brands offer excellent optical clarity. Holosun typically offers a brighter and clearer sight picture in some models, which can make a difference in bright sunlight. Sig Sauer models provide a clean sight picture and a well-defined reticle for easy aiming. Target acquisition speeds are excellent for both. The choice here often comes down to user preference.
Warranty & Customer Support
Sig Sauer provides a robust warranty and a well-regarded customer support system. Holosun offers a comprehensive warranty, but opinions on customer service can vary.
